Steady-state creep data taken for an iron at a stress level of 140 MPa (20,000 psi) are given here:
s (h-1) ________________ T (K)
6.6 × 10-4 ..................... 1090
8.8 × 10-2 ..................... 1200
If it is known that the value of the stress exponent n for this alloy is 8.5, compute the steady-state creep rate at 1300 K and a stress level of 83 MPa (12,000 psi)?
